History and Establishment of Shanwei Zoo
Shanwei Zoo was established with the goal of creating an educational and recreational hub that promotes wildlife conservation. Opened in the early 2000s, the zoo has grown exponentially in both size and reputation, gaining recognition for its commitment to animal welfare. The founders envisioned a space where people could connect with nature and develop a deeper understanding of the ecological challenges facing our planet.
The zoo initially started with a modest collection of local fauna but has since expanded to include animals from around the globe. Over the years, it has partnered with various international conservation organizations to enhance its facilities, improve animal care, and raise awareness about endangered species. Today, Shanwei Zoo is a leading example of how zoos can serve as educational platforms while prioritizing the well-being of their inhabitants.
What Makes Shanwei Zoo Unique?
Several factors set Shanwei Zoo apart from other wildlife parks and zoos. One of the most notable features is its emphasis on creating naturalistic habitats for its animals. These enclosures are designed to replicate the animals' native ecosystems, ensuring their physical and psychological well-being. Visitors can observe the animals in settings that closely resemble their natural environments, making the experience both authentic and fulfilling.
Another unique aspect is the zoo's dedication to conservation and research. Shanwei Zoo actively participates in breeding programs for endangered species, contributing to global efforts to prevent extinction. The zoo also serves as a research center, collaborating with scientists to study animal behavior, health, and genetics.
How does Shanwei Zoo prioritize animal welfare?
The welfare of its animals is at the core of Shanwei Zoo’s mission. The zoo employs a team of veterinarians, nutritionists, and animal behaviorists who work tirelessly to provide top-notch care. Regular health check-ups, tailored diets, and enrichment activities are just some of the measures taken to ensure the animals' well-being.
What role does education play at Shanwei Zoo?
Education is a cornerstone of Shanwei Zoo’s philosophy. Through guided tours, interactive exhibits, and workshops, the zoo educates visitors about wildlife conservation and the importance of protecting our planet. Schools often partner with the zoo to provide students with hands-on learning experiences that complement their classroom studies.

How Was Shanwei Zoo Created?
The creation of Shanwei Zoo was a collaborative effort involving local authorities, wildlife experts, and environmental organizations. The idea was to transform a neglected area into a thriving wildlife sanctuary that would serve both the community and the environment. The project received significant funding from both public and private sectors, enabling the construction of state-of-the-art facilities.
During the planning phase, experts conducted extensive research to identify the best practices for zoo management. This included studying successful models from around the world and consulting with conservationists to ensure that the zoo met international standards. The result was a facility that not only houses animals but also contributes to scientific research and environmental education.
